Transaction 58eed673b9ddbf6d9c6c39845d1daa033bba6958765df5c39b2bed8bb8494e58
1 Input
1 Output
-
58eed673b9ddbf6d9c6c39845d1daa033bba6958765df5c39b2bed8bb8494e58:0
- value
- 315972
- script pubkey
- OP_0 OP_PUSHBYTES_20 2df859650e5b56fa834e809dd6ce5d4e58442d99
- address
- bc1q9hu9jegwtdt04q6wszwadnjafevygtve0alrft